A gunn diode also known as a transferred electron device ted is a form of diode a two terminal passive semiconductor electronic component with negative resistance used in high frequency electronics. Spacequalifiedsubmillimeter radiometer developed a 560 ghz radiometer with a solid state phase locked gunn diode.

It is used to generate rf and microwave frequencies. It is a negative differential resistance device also called as transferred electron device oscillator which is a tuned circuit consisting of gunn diode with dc bias voltage applied to it. Gunndiode is mainly used as a local oscillator covering the microwave frequency range of 1 to 100ghz by means of the transferred electron mechanism the negative resistance characteristic can be obtained.

N type and utilizes the negative resistance characteristics to generate current at high frequencies. This mechanism provides low noise high frequency operation and medium rf power characteristic.
